Treatment can help those with ADHD focus better, become less impulsive and more relaxed. It usually involves an amalgamation of medication and therapy.
Stimulants stimulate brain activity in the areas that regulate attention and behavior. Methylphenidate (known as Ritalin) is one of the most frequently prescribed medications to treat adults suffering from ADHD.
Stimulants
Stimulants are drugs that boost activity in the parts of the brain responsible for the behavior and attention. They are typically prescribed as part of cognitive behavioral therapy (CBT). Stimulants increase the levels of dopamine and norepinephrine in your brain. This helps you focus and lessens the impact of certain impulses such as those that trigger impulsive behavior. Children and adults can tolerate stimulants well, however certain individuals may experience adverse effects like jitteriness and headaches.

The drug lisdexamfetamine is now approved in the UK and has an advantage over short-acting stimulants as it does not fade over the course of the daytime. It only requires one dose a day. Patients used to take short-acting amphetamines 3 or four times per day. It was a challenge for patients to remember to take and could result in an inability to adhere.
It is essential to obtain an accurate medical history in order to determine if someone suffering from ADHD may have other conditions that contribute to their symptoms. A medical condition like sleep apnea, thyroid disorders or other issues might be causing your child's exhaustion or difficulty in concentrating. It is also important to mention any issues with the use of substances to your doctor, since the excessive use of illegal, prescription or over the counter drugs could have an impact on your child's ability to focus.

Parents should not rush to decide whether or not to treat their child for ADHD. It's a lengthy and complex procedure. Many children will suffer from side effects like insomnia, irritability and anxiety, but the majority times, these are able to be overcome through careful monitoring and gradual increase of dosages.
Some parents choose private treatment that includes an ongoing series of appointments with a psychiatrist to begin treatment and monitor progress. This may involve five or more appointments and thereafter, fortnightly or monthly appointments as the child becomes used to the medication. This is an excellent option for families who find the NHS waiting lists to be extremely long and those who have private healthcare that can provide a more efficient and convenient access to healthcare. Your GP will be provided with a thorough report on the progress of your child. He or she can monitor the medication that was prescribed by your psychiatrist. In some cases, you may return to the NHS for this procedure to continue to ensure that your GP is aware of all medications prescribed to your child and will conduct regular checks and reviews.
